So I've played about an hour of the game. Awesome game so far, but I'm confused but I few things. Do you get your "souls" back by killing the enemy that killed you? If so, are you just screwed if you adventured too far and fought a tough enemy? Also, I feel like my pistol is weak. What are the basic strategies to using the gun to your advantage?

When you die your souls drop at the spot where you died. There's a chance an enemy nearby might claim at which point you'd have to kill them.

The pistol isn't really meant for damage. If you time using it correctly while an enemy is attacking, you'll get them in a downed state. Run up to them and hit R1 for massive damage.
